Aaron Judge is receiving the full Barry Bonds treatment after performing his best Barry Bonds impression all season. The Yankees’ slugger walked four times in five plate appearances on Tuesday against the Toronto Blue Jays at OKBet Baseball 2022, leaving him one home run short of breaking Roger Maris’ single-season AL record of 61.

The Yankees, on the other hand, are unconcerned. At least for the time being. Judge came back to score twice in a 5-2 New York victory against the division foe Blue Jays. The Yankees’ first title since 2019 and their second since 2012. Judge and his colleagues celebrated with champagne, but his quest for history remained on hold.

And, with eight games left on the Yankees’ schedule, what looked like a certain outcome when Judge hit No. 60 on Sept. 20 has become less certain. Especially because no one appears to want to offer him something to hit. Since reaching No. 60, Judge’s walk rate has increased to 38.7%. (12 in 31 plate appearances). While leading the AL in free passes, his full-season walk rate is 15.7% (105/667).

Bonds’ astonishing highest full-season walk rate in 2004 was 37.6% (232/617). While comparing a seven-game sample size to a full season is statistically ludicrous, it is evident that pitchers are avoiding sending balls over the plate. Nobody wants to be on the wrong end of such a momentous moment. Judge is content for the time being on OKBet Baseball 2022..

“Every day, I’ll take four walks for a victory,” Judge stated on Tuesday. Let’s see how he feels after a week if he’s still stuck on 60.

The Aaron Judge New York Yankees have won the American League East and will have a first-round bye in the 2022 playoffs.

Throughout the season, Aaron Judge has mentioned several times that the Yankees’ top priority was to win the division. That aim was fulfilled by the Yankees in their 154th game of the season, a 5-2 triumph against the second-place Blue Jays in front of 40,528 spectators at Rogers Centre on Tuesday night at OKBet.

Judge continues to chase Roger Maris’ team and AL single-season record of 61 home runs, walking four times after lining out in his first at-bat. However, Judge scored twice on two of Gleyber Torres’ three RBI singles during Torres’ outstanding September.

Jameson Taillon pitched into the eighth inning, Lou Trivino coaxed a crucial double play grounder in the eighth, and Clay Holmes finished it out in the ninth, sparking a champagne party in the clubhouse at OKBet.

OKBet Baseball Yankees won their second division championship under manager Aaron Boone, clinching a No. 2 seed and gaining direct admission into the best-of-five AL Division Series under MLB’s new postseason structure.

Boone won his first AL East title in 2019.

The Yankees last won the AL East in 2012, when Joe Girardi was in charge. The Yankees were eliminated in the AL Championship Series in each of those seasons.

Building up and fighting back
On the morning of July 9, the Yankees had a 15.5-game lead in the AL East, their season high. At the All-Star break, the Yankees led by 13 games and were still being compared to the 1998 world champions, who won a franchise-record 114 regular-season games.

However, injuries continued to mount, the bullpen began to struggle, and the Yankees’ advantage in the loss column was shrunk to two games over the Tampa Bay Rays on Sept. 10. Since then, the Yankees (95-57) have won 12 of their past 15 games, thanks to improved bullpen pitching and the return of starter Luis Severino and first baseman Anthony Rizzo.
